The TrainingBeta Podcast
The Best Resource for Climbing Training Beta
On the TrainingBeta Podcast, Neely Quinn talks to climbers, coaches, physical therapists, and other professionals about how to get better at rock climbing. As a nutritionist and a mindset coach, she offers her own expertise to the mix as well. You can expect to find actionable advice and meaningful conversations on this podcast that will help you train smarter, fuel yourself better, and find more fulfillment in your rock climbing.
